On this episode of Represent, Aisha Harris talks to Wesley Snipes about his cult superhero movie Blade and trying to bring Black Panther to the big screen more than 20 years ago. Also, Ash Clark, Brooklyn Academy of Music’s senior programmer, joins us to discuss curating the film series Fight the Power: Black Superheroes on Film.
